The R&D activity of Ana Estanqueiro has been focused in the area of Renewable Energies, mainly in the integration of Wind Energy - and other renewable generation variable in time - in the grid and the electric power system.
Throughout her research career she has dedicated himself to research in the area of Wind Energy and Renewable Energies, in a comprehensive way, developing R&D projects, promoting the development of the renewable sector, from the construction of resources atlases, and wind potential databases, to the development of methodologies for planning the use of distributed renewable sources (wind and photovoltaic) and the design and construction of micro-turbines.
Her recent research interest and projects also address the negotiation and increase of value of variable renewable generation (wind and PV) through the design of new electricity markets and products.
